Blackstone Weighs Stake in India's IIFL Finance as Fairfax Eyes Exit
Blackstone is reportedly considering acquiring a significant stake in IIFL Finance, an Indian financial services firm, while Fairfax Financial reportedly plans to exit its position.

This potential transaction signals major shifts in the ownership structure of a key player in India’s non-banking financial company sector. For professionals, this highlights the increasing interest of global private equity firms in emerging market financial institutions. The move underscores the dynamic nature of cross-border investment and the strategic realignment of assets within the financial industry, suggesting broader trends in capital allocation and corporate restructuring in developing economies.
